InterPlanetary File System: History & Applications

The InterPlanetary File System (IPFS) is a protocol, hypermedia and file sharing peer-to-peer network for sharing data using a distributed hash table to store provider information. By using content addressing, IPFS uniquely identifies each file in a global namespace that connects IPFS hosts, creating a distributed system of file storage and sharing.
